    Judy Ann Nugent (August 22, 1940 – October 26, 2023) was an American actress. Early life. Judy Ann Nugent was born on August 22, 1940, in Los Angeles, California. She was the daughter of Carl Leon Nugent and Lucille Jane Redd. Her older sister, Carol Nugent, also became an actress. [1] [2] [3] [4] [5] Career.

  5. Judy Nugent was an American child actress of the 1950s, known for her roles in The Ruggles, Magnificent Obsession and Annette. She died in 2023 at the age of 83 after a long career in show business and ranching in Montana.
